Remembering 14-Year-Old Haley Gans, Killed In Skiing Accident
Colorado Springs A terrible accident at the Breckenridge Ski Resort has one Colorado Springs family mourning. Haley Gans, at the fragile age of 14, hit a tree and died while skiing down her last run on Friday.

A terrible accident at the Breckenridge Ski Resort has one Colorado Springs family mourning. Haley Gans, at the fragile age of 14, hit a tree and died while skiing down her last run on Friday.
Haley's mom, Patricia, told 11 News the whole family has been crying non-stop. So, on Sunday, they decided to make it a happier day by remembering and cherishing moments from when Haley was still alive.
Her family tells 11 News Haley was wildly talented and so very sweet. "She spread love to everybody," said Haley's older brother, Jake Gans.
Family and friends are still trying to take it all in and trying to understand why this had to happen to her. "At one point, the mind kind of stops," said Francisca Schreier who is a close family friend.
Everyone who knew Haley said she had a special place in her heart for figure skating. "If she wasn't ice skating she was on her horse or at the beach," said Jake Gans.
Haley also loved hitting the slopes. Her family says she was excellent at that, too. "Every time we went down the ski slope she was the first one down almost every time," said Jake Gans.
Her big sister Rebekah and Francisca say they have so many fond memories of little Haley. "She loved dress up as a kid. Us three girls would always get dressed up," said Schreier.
Haley also had a little partner in crime, her pug dog Sushi. Haley was hearing impaired so she always had her buddy with her, but her family says her disability never defined her or prevented her from doing anything she wanted. "She grew up being this special person. She was strong in her own way," said Schreier.
Haley's big sister Rebekah wrote this for her sister. "Haley was a beautiful and loving light in my life and I can not express how much I will miss her. I love you my beautiful little sister and will hold you in my heart forever."
Haley's brother Jake says he plans to get a tattoo on his chest in memory of his baby sister.
Haley was wearing her helmet when she hit the tree. Authorities say she died of blunt force trauma to her body.
